What You'll Do
Lead and support affordable housing developments from site selection through closing and construction
Play a key role in structuring and closing LIHTC transactions and other layered financing deals
Identify and evaluate new development opportunities across Colorado markets
Manage pre-development efforts including feasibility analysis, entitlements, and funding strategy
Prepare and submit competitive applications for LIHTC and other public financing sources
Represent projects in community meetings, public hearings, and stakeholder presentations
Coordinate across internal teams and external partners to keep projects moving forward
Travel to project sites throughout Colorado, including mountain regions, to stay connected to progress
